> Starting with kernel 7.0.0, sockets support extended attributes in the
> user.* namespace. This behavior was enabled by dc0876b9846d ("xattr: support
> extended attributes on sockets"), which permits user.* xattrs on S_IFSOCK
> inodes (previously rejected with -EPERM).
